Heavy Duty 4091 Polypropylene Chemical Hose

Polypropylene lined composite hose with stainless steel inner wire, and either galvanized steel (4091) or stainless steel (4094) outer wire.

Engineered with 100% chemical resistant barrier layers embedded in the hose wall to prevent permeation and leakage. Available in sizes from 1” to 4” diameter, hose assemblies are conductive and capable of full vacuum. A diverse selection of end fittings are available. Working pressures of up to 250 psi (17 bar) and temperatures of up to 100 degrees C (212 F).

Applications

This type is designed for use as a tank truck, railcar, and in plant transfer hose suitable for use with a wide variety of chemicals with maximum resistant T316 Stainless Steel inner wire is required.

Description

Construction

  • Color/Cover: 4091SGP Royal Blue White Stripe/PVC Coated Nylon, Abrasion, Ozone Resistant; 4094SSP Royal Blue Yellow Stripe/PVC Coated Nylon, Abrasion, Ozone Resistant
  • Inner Wire: T316 Stainless Steel Wire
  • Inner Lining: High Grade Polypropylene
  • Carcass: Polypropylene Fabrics, Films and Seamless Tubes
  • Outer Wire: 4091SGP Galvanized Steel; 4094SSP T304 or T316 Stainless Steel
  • Extra: Special Color Coding and Branding

Physical Properties

  • Temperature Range: -22°F to +212°F (-30°C to +100°C)
  • Maximum Elongation: ≤10% on test pressure
  • Vacuum Range: 26 inHg (660 mmHg), 0.9 bar
  • Electrical Properties: Electrically Conductive; ≤2.5 ohm/m for sizes less than 2″; ≤1.0 ohm/m for size 2″ and above

End Fittings

Specially designed end fittings have been developed for use with Willcox Composite hoses that have a unique leak-proof sealing face and specially machined helical spiral shank which engages into the corresponding internal helix wire when secured into the hose by either crimping or swaging the external ferrules.
